Hisayasu

/hi.sa.ja.sɯ/

🔥🔥
Uncommon

Meaning

Long peace or enduring tranquility

Represents the aspiration for lasting harmony, stability, and a peaceful life, often reflecting familial hopes for societal or personal serenity.

Symbolism

Embodies the values of patience, balance, and resilience; symbolizes a calm strength and the ideal of sustained well-being across generations.

Etymology: Derived from the Japanese elements 'hisa' (久), meaning 'long' or 'enduring,' and 'yasu' (安 or 靖), meaning 'peace' or 'tranquility'; commonly found in samurai names from the Edo and Sengoku periods.
